    So with the header install I needed to extend the harness. I purchased a brand new O2 sensor from ZZP & extended harness myself.

    However, extending the harness came with some problems http://www.grandprixforums.net/makin...ere-67540.html

    Now I am getting code 1133, I ended up guessing which of the 2 unmarked white wires goes where - guess that failed or the extension is too long & throwing out bad readings? Anyone have a picture of an O2 sensor showing exactly what wires from the plub end go into what position on the sensor end?

    I would hate to throw away a sensor with 50 miles on it.
